Floods cut off communities in Elmina

The Surowi River has overflowed its banks following torrential rains, cutting off the Atonkwa and Abeena communities, near Elmina in the Central Region.

Yesterday, vehicles could not move to the two communities, as the floodwaters spilled over onto the main road.

Schoolchildren from other villages who attend school in the two towns and their teachers could not attend school.

The Municipal Officer of the National Disaster Management Organisation (NADMO), Mr Patrick Obeng Yeboah, said a situation report would be sent to the NADMO Regional Office for further action.

“We have assessed the situation and will send our report to the regional office tomorrow”.

Mr Yeboah explained that the bridge over the Surowi River was too small and a major contributor to what had become the perennial flooding.

As a result of that, he said, the river overflowed its banks onto the road any time there was a downpour.
